The size of Clayfield is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 1.6% of total area. The population of Clayfield in 2016 was 10555 people. By 2021 the population was 10897 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clayfield is 30-39 years. Households in Clayf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clayf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 55.00% of the homes in Clayfield were owner-occupied compared with 52.40% in 2016.
